ABSTRACT

To investigate the role of specific adrenoreceptors subtypes on sexual behavior, atenolol, butoxamine, a mixture of atenolol and butoxamine, and saline (vehicle) were injected into the lateral septum in four different groups of sexually active male rats. Application of a mixture of atenolol and butoxamine produced inhibition of copulatory activity. On the other hand, application of either atenolol or butoxamine alone did not inhibit copulatory activity. But it produced stimulation of some of the components of male sexual behavior. Inability of either atenolol or butoxamine to inhibit the male sexual behavior, and inhibition of the same by the mixture of atenolol and butoxamine, indicate that both beta-adrenoreceptors at the lateral septum are involved in the elaboration of male sexual behavior. Stimulation of some components of sexual behavior on application of atenolol or butoxamine could be attributed to an unbalanced activity of beta-adrenoreceptors.

ABSTRACT

The present study was designed to investigate the role of central adrenoceptors in the hypotensive effect of intracerebroventricular (ICV) injection of norepinephrine (NE) in conscious rabbits. Experiments were carried out on 19 adult rabbits (oryctolagus cuniculus) of either sex. A dose-dependent hypotensive response to ICV injection of NE was observed with no significant change in heart rate. The hypotensive response of NE was blocked 74.2 +/- 0.7% by yohimbine (alpha-2 adrenergic blocker), and 25.0 +/- 0.5% by metoprolol (beta-1 adrenergic blocker). NE response was not affected either by prazosin or butoxamine (alpha-1 and beta-2 adrenergic blockers respectively). The results suggest that the dose-dependent hypotensive response of ICV administered NE is mediated through alpha-2 and beta-1 central adrenoceptors.
